Ozona athletic director and football coach Jarryd Taylor departs

OZONA — Ozona ISD athletic director and football coach Jarryd Taylor accepted a new job as the defensive coordinator at Class 5A Alice in South Texas.

Taylor spent the past five years at the helm in Ozona, compiling a record of 28-26 with four playoff appearances.

Last season, the Lions finished third in District 3-2A Division I with a 7-4 record.

Taylor is an Ozona native, where he played linebacker under his father, Steve Taylor, earning all-state honors from 2000-03. After graduating from Ozona High School in 2004, he attended SMU and then transferred to Hardin-Simmons University to finish his football career.

Taylor also had stops at Brownfield, Coahoma, Colorado City and Midland High before taking the job at his alma mater.
